@import url(/wp-content/themes/bridge-child/../bridge/style.css);@charset "UTF-8"@font-face{font-family:'Roboto';src:url(/wp-content/themes/bridge-child/assets/fonts/Roboto-Regular.woff2) format("woff2"),url(/wp-content/themes/bridge-child/assets/fonts/Roboto-Regular.woff) format("woff"),url(/wp-content/themes/bridge-child/assets/fonts/Roboto-Regular.ttf) format("ttf")}*{box-sizing:border-box}body{font-family:Roboto,sans-serif}.flexslider .slides img,.portfolio_slider .portfolio_slides img,.qode_carousels .slides img{display:block;width:220px!important}@media only screen and (max-width:1024px){nav.main_menu>ul>li>a{color:#9d9d9d;font-size:13px;font-weight:600;letter-spacing:1px;padding:0 10px!important;position:relative;text-transform:uppercase}.header_bottom{background-color:#fff;padding:0 25px;transition:all 0.2s ease 0s}}.qode_carousels .slides>li{    margin:0 2px 0 0;    width:initial!important}.qode_carousels{display:block;padding-left:5%;position:relative}.content.has_slider .content_inner .full_width,.content.has_slider .content_inner .container{position:relative}.standort-akkordeon p{font-size:14px;line-height:23px}.kontakt_formular-tabs .wpcf7-checkbox .wpcf7-list-item{display:block}.standort-akkordeon .vc_column_container{margin-bottom:15px}.q_accordion_holder.accordion.boxed .ui-accordion-header{background-color:#f5f5f5;text-align:center}.blog_holder article .post_info a,.blog_holder article .post_text h2 .date{color:#bebebe}.blog_holder article .post_info{color:#bebebe;display:none;font-weight:500;margin:0 0 18px;width:100%}ul,ol{list-style-position:outside;margin-left:20px}li{margin:10px 0}footer{z-index:10}.button-fixed-contact{position:fixed;top:72%;left:20px;width:80px;height:80px;background-size:80px 80px;background-color:#0d265d;background-repeat:no-repeat;text-align:center;line-height:2em;color:#fff;font-size:2.3em;border-radius:40px;cursor:pointer;z-index:110}.contact-icon.robee-contact{font-size:.9em;content:"\f003"}.width-lightbox{max-width:450px;margin:auto}.nivo-lightbox-wrap{max-width:800px;margin:auto}.lightbox-hide-on-mobile{display:block}.lightbox-show-on-mobile{display:none}@media only all and (max-width:1000px){#lightbox-app .content{top:50px;height:calc(100% - 75px)}.lightbox-text{zoom:.8}.lightbox-hide-on-mobile{display:none}.lightbox-show-on-mobile{display:block}.mobile_menu_button{float:right;margin:0pt}.mobile_menu_button .fa{font-size:18px!important}}nav.main_menu ul li a{font-weight:400;font-size:14px}nav.main_menu>ul>li>a{font-weight:400;font-size:14px;padding:0 15px}footer h5{font-weight:400}h2,h2 a{font-size:26px}.section-title{color:#0d265d;margin-bottom:35px;font-size:26px;text-transform:none;font-weight:400}.section-title:after{border-bottom:1px solid #0d265d;height:1px;position:absolute;display:block;content:"";width:190px;margin:15px 0}.section-subtitle{color:#0d265d;font-size:26px}@media (min-width:769px){h2,h2 a{font-size:32px}}.blog_holder.blog_single article.post{background-color:#fff;padding:15px;margin:20px 0}.blog_holder.blog_single article.post .post_image{margin-bottom:15px}.blog_holder.blog_single article.post .post_text{margin-top:15px}.blog_holder.blog_single article.post .post_text .post_text_inner{padding:0}.blog_holder.blog_single article h1,.blog_holder.blog_single article .h1,.blog_holder.blog_single article h1 a{display:block;font-size:26px;color:#0d265d;font-weight:500;text-transform:none}@media (min-width:769px){.blog_holder.blog_single article.post .post_image{float:left;margin-right:20px;max-width:300px}.blog_holder.blog_single article.post .post_text{margin-top:15px}.blog_holder.blog_single article.post .post_text .post_text_inner{padding:0}.blog_holder.blog_single article h1,.blog_holder.blog_single article .h1,.blog_holder.blog_single article h1 a{font-size:32px}}footer .newsletter-signup .field_label{color:#fff}footer .newsletter-signup input.wpcf7-form-control.wpcf7-submit:not([disabled]){border-color:#fff;color:#fff}footer .newsletter-signup ul{margin:0}footer .newsletter-signup .form_button{margin-top:15px}footer .newsletter-signup .wpcf7-submit{border-color:#fff;color:#fff}footer .newsletter-signup .form_field{box-sizing:border-box;width:100%}@media (min-width:768px){footer .newsletter-signup .form_field{width:80%}}.fm-news-list>article{margin:15px 0;padding:20px;background-color:#fff}.fm-news-list .entry_title{font-size:22px;text-transform:none}.fm-news-list .post-excerpt{font-size:16px}.fm-news-list .entry_date{font-size:14px}.fm-news-list .cover_boxes_read_more{font-size:16px}@media (min-width:601px){.fm-news-list .fm-post-image{float:left;margin-right:20px;max-width:280px}}.standort-link a:before{content:"\f101";font-family:"fontawesome";margin-right:5px}.standort-phone a{color:#002e52}.staff-gallery{list-style:none;margin:40px 0}.staff-gallery li{position:relative;float:left;line-height:0;margin:0 1px 1px 0}.staff-gallery li:hover .mitarbeiter-info{display:block}.staff-gallery .mitarbeiter-image{width:100%}.staff-gallery .mitarbeiter-info{display:none;text-align:center;position:absolute;left:0;right:0;bottom:0;background-color:rgba(0,0,0,.6)}.staff-gallery .mitarbeiter-info .name{font-size:12px}.staff-gallery .mitarbeiter-info p{font-size:10px;color:#fff;line-height:normal}.department{margin-top:40px}.department .section-title{font-size:22px;margin-bottom:60px}.staff-list{list-style:none;margin:0;padding:0}.staff-list>li{margin:0 0 40px;position:relative;height:350px;min-height:320px}.staff-list>li>.mitarbeiter{max-width:300px}.staff-list>li>.mitarbeiter>.name{margin-top:10px;font-size:20px;color:#bbb}.staff-list .description>p{margin:0;font-size:16px;line-height:1.4}@media (min-width:340px){.staff-gallery li{margin:1px;width:calc(50% - 2px)}}@media (min-width:481px){.staff-gallery li{width:calc(33.33% - 2px)}}@media (min-width:601px){.staff-gallery li{width:calc(25% - 2px)}}@media (min-width:768px){.staff-gallery li{width:calc(20% - 2px)}.staff-list>li{display:flex;float:left;width:50%}.staff-list>li:nth-child(2n+2){justify-content:flex-start}}@media (min-width:1001px){.staff-gallery li{width:calc(12.5% - 2px)}.staff-list>li{width:33.33%}.staff-list>li:nth-child(3n+1){justify-content:flex-start}.staff-list>li:nth-child(3n+2){justify-content:center}.staff-list>li:nth-child(3n+3){justify-content:flex-end}}
/*! Gray v1.6.0 (https://github.com/karlhorky/gray) | MIT */
.grayscale{filter: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g'><filter id='grayscale'><feColorMatrix type='saturate' values='0'/></filter></svg>#grayscale");-webkit-filter:grayscale(1);filter:grayscale(1);filter:gray}.grayscale.grayscale-fade{transition:filter .5s}@media screen and (-webkit-min-device-pixel-ratio:0){.grayscale.grayscale-fade{-webkit-transition:-webkit-filter .5s;transition:-webkit-filter .5s}}.grayscale.grayscale-off{-webkit-filter:grayscale(0);filter:grayscale(0)}.staff-gallery li:hover .grayscale.grayscale-fade{-webkit-filter:grayscale(0);filter:grayscale(0)}.grayscale.grayscale-replaced{-webkit-filter:none;filter:none}.grayscale.grayscale-replaced>svg{-webkit-transition:opacity .5s ease;transition:opacity .5s ease;opacity:1}.grayscale.grayscale-replaced.grayscale-off>svg{opacity:0}.staff-gallery li:hover .grayscale.grayscale-replaced.grayscale-fade>svg{opacity:0}#text-3{margin:0 0 0 0}.fm-cto .qbutton{text-transform:none}.title_subtitle_holder{margin-top:1.5em}.title.title_size_small h1{font-size:20px;line-height:1.304347826086957em}.hidden{display:none}.wpb_content_element.newsletter-signup h2{margin-bottom:.5em}.wpb_content_element.newsletter-signup input.wpcf7-form-control.wpcf7-text{background-color:#fff}.wpb_content_element.newsletter-signup .newsletter-form{display:flex;flex-direction:column;align-items:center}.wpb_content_element.newsletter-signup .newsletter-form .wpcf7-text{margin:0 0 12px 0;flex:1 1 auto}.wpb_content_element.newsletter-signup .newsletter-form .wpcf7-submit{width:100%;text-align:center;box-sizing:border-box}@media (min-width:601px){.wpb_content_element.newsletter-signup{padding:0 24px}.wpb_content_element.newsletter-signup .newsletter-form{flex-direction:row}.wpb_content_element.newsletter-signup .newsletter-form .wpcf7-text{margin:0 12px 0 0}.wpb_content_element.newsletter-signup .newsletter-form .wpcf7-submit{width:auto}}@media (min-width:640px){.wpb_content_element.newsletter-signup{padding:0}}.fm-map-wrapper{overflow:hidden}.fm-map{margin-left:50%;transform:translateX(-50%);height:540px}.fm-contact-forms .qode-advanced-tabs .qode-advanced-tab-container{background-color:transparent}.qode-advanced-tabs.qode-advanced-horizontal-tab .qode-advanced-tabs-nav li.ui-state-hover a{color:#fff}.qode-advanced-tabs.qode-advanced-horizontal-tab .qode-advanced-tabs-nav li.ui-state-hover a{color:#fff}.qode-advanced-tabs.qode-advanced-horizontal-tab .qode-advanced-tabs-nav li.ui-state-active.ui-state-hover a{color:#0d265d}.fm-homepage-cta{display:flex;flex-direction:column;overflow:hidden;background-color:#0d265d}.fm-homepage-cta .cta-bauma{position:relative;display:flex;justify-content:center;padding-top:25px;padding-bottom:25px;background-color:#ef7d00}.fm-homepage-cta .cta-lgo{display:flex;justify-content:center;padding-top:25px;padding-bottom:25px}@media (min-width:768px){.fm-homepage-cta{flex-direction:row}.fm-homepage-cta .cta-bauma-bg{position:absolute;top:0;bottom:0;left:0;right:-100%;transform:skewX(-45deg);background-color:#ef7d00}.fm-homepage-cta .cta-lgo{width:50%}.fm-homepage-cta .cta-bauma{background-color:transparent;width:50%}}.bauma-slider-cta{position:absolute;display:flex;flex-direction:column;overflow:hidden;color:#fff;top:0;left:0;height:190px;width:100%;padding-top:40px;padding-left:40px;z-index:10}.bauma-slider-cta:before{position:absolute;content:"";top:0;bottom:0;left:-130px;width:400px;background-color:#002f52;transform:skewX(-45deg);z-index:9}.bauma-slider-cta-title{font-size:30px;font-weight:700;z-index:10}.bauma-slider-cta-content{font-size:20px;padding-top:20px;line-height:2;z-index:10}@media (min-width:375px){.bauma-slider-cta:before{}}@media (min-width:768px){.bauma-slider-cta{height:auto;bottom:0}.bauma-slider-cta:before{left:-300px;width:460px}}@media (min-width:1001px){.bauma-slider-cta{padding-top:140px;padding-left:60px}.bauma-slider-cta:before{left:-300px;width:580px}.bauma-slider-cta-title{font-size:30px;font-weight:700;z-index:10}.bauma-slider-cta-content{font-size:20px;padding-top:80px;line-height:2;z-index:10}}@media (min-width:1300px){.bauma-slider-cta{}.bauma-slider-cta:before{left:-300px;width:680px}.bauma-slider-cta-title{font-size:30px;font-weight:700;padding-top:20px;z-index:10}.bauma-slider-cta-content{font-size:20px;padding-top:120px;line-height:2;z-index:10}}input.wpcf7-form-control.wpcf7-date,input.wpcf7-form-control.wpcf7-number,input.wpcf7-form-control.wpcf7-quiz,input.wpcf7-form-control.wpcf7-text,select.wpcf7-form-control.wpcf7-select,textarea.wpcf7-form-control.wpcf7-textarea{font-family:Roboto,sans-serif}@media (width>=768px){.md\:block{display:block}.md\:hidden{display:none}}@media (width < 481px){.max-sm\:text-\[22px\]{font-size:22px}}@media (width>1000px){.q_logo a{height:60px!important}}